Why Solar-Powered 220V Water Pumps Are Revolutionizing Water Management
Water pumps powered by solar energy and equipped with remote control capabilities are no longer a futuristic concept—they're here, and they're solving critical challenges in sectors like agriculture, construction, and off-grid communities. Let's break down why these systems are gaining traction globally.
Key Applications Across Industries
- Agriculture: Irrigation systems in remote farms where grid power is unreliable.
- Residential Use: Backup water supply for homes in areas with frequent power outages.
- Industrial Operations: Efficient water transfer for construction sites or mining projects.
"Solar pumps reduce diesel dependency by up to 90%, making them a game-changer for rural communities." – Renewable Energy Analyst
How Remote Control Enhances Solar Water Pump Systems
Imagine adjusting water flow or scheduling pump operations from your smartphone. Remote control integration eliminates manual monitoring and optimizes energy usage. For example, farmers in Kenya use SMS-based controls to manage irrigation cycles during droughts.
Technical Advantages at a Glance
- Real-time monitoring via IoT sensors.
- Automatic shutdown during low sunlight.
- Compatibility with 220V AC appliances.
Case Study: Solar Pump ROI in Agricultural Settings
| Metric | Diesel Pump | Solar Pump |
|---|---|---|
| Annual Fuel Cost | $2,800 | $0 |
| Maintenance | $500 | $150 |
| CO2 Emissions (tons/year) | 4.2 | 0 |
Latest Trends in Solar Pump Technology
The market for solar water pumps is growing at 8% annually, driven by innovations like hybrid systems (solar + grid) and AI-driven predictive maintenance. Countries like India and Brazil now offer subsidies to accelerate adoption.
